Overview of Flexible Printed Circuits in the Electronics Industry
Flexible printed circuits (FPCs) have gained significant traction in the electronics industry due to their unique advantages. They offer lightweight solutions and enhanced design flexibility. A report by Technavio estimates the global flexible printed circuit market will exceed $29 billion by 2025. This growth comes from the increasing demand in sectors like consumer electronics and automotive.
The advantages of FPCs include reduced space requirements and the ability to bend and twist. This adaptability is crucial in small devices such as smartphones and wearables. However, manufacturers face challenges in quality control and material selection. Materials must meet rigorous standards to ensure durability and performance. The process is not always straightforward, leading to potential inconsistencies.
As FPC technology continues to evolve, the industry must address these challenges. Innovating production methods is essential for enhancing reliability. Furthermore, companies should focus on sustainable materials to meet rising environmental standards. Balancing performance with eco-friendliness will be vital in attracting conscientious consumers. Key Features and Advantages of Flexible Printed Circuits
Flexible printed circuits (FPCs) offer several key features that make them a popular choice in various industries. These circuits are lightweight, which helps reduce the overall weight of electronic devices. Their design allows for more intricate layouts, enabling compact and efficient use of space. This flexibility allows for integration in devices that require bending or twisting. It’s crucial for wearable technology and mobile devices.
Another significant advantage is their durability. FPCs can withstand harsh conditions, including extreme temperatures and humidity. This resilience leads to longer product life cycles. However, quality control can sometimes be a challenge in manufacturing these circuits. Ensuring consistent performance across all units requires rigorous testing and inspection.
Cost-effectiveness is also a factor to consider. While FPCs may have a higher initial cost, their efficiency often leads to savings in the long run. Trends and Future Prospects for Flexible Printed Circuits in China
Flexible printed circuits (FPCs) are vital in modern electronics. They offer numerous advantages, such as lightweight design and flexibility. According to a report by MarketsandMarkets, the FPC market is projected to reach $36.57 billion by 2025, growing at a CAGR of 10.9%. This growth indicates a strong demand for advanced flexible circuits in various industries.
China sees a surge in FPC production. The country is becoming a key player, with more local manufacturers entering the market. A study by ResearchAndMarkets highlights that China accounted for over 50% of global FPC production in 2021. However, challenges remain, including quality control and rising material costs. Many manufacturers must address these issues to remain competitive.
Emerging trends in the FPC sector include increased adoption of automation and development of advanced materials. The shift to IoT and wearable technology drives the demand for innovative designs.
